STRATEGIC REPORT |
for the Year Ended 31 MARCH 2016 |
|
The directors present their strategic report for the year ended 31 March 2016. |
|
REVIEW OF BUSINESS |
We aim to present a balanced and comprehensive review of the development and performance of our business during |
the year and its position at the year end. Our review is consistent with the size and non-complex nature of our business |
and is written in the context of the risks and uncertainties we face. |
|
The company continues to operate as an express coach operator along with providing private hire for the general public. |
|
We consider that our key financial performance indicators are those that communicate the financial performance and |
strength of the company as a whole, these being turnover and operating profit. |
|
|
2016 | 2015 |
£ | £ |
Turnover | 27,776,094 | 27,393,620 |
|
Turnover has increased by over 1.4%. |
|
Operating profit has reduced from £3,277,008 to £3,189,365. Profit before tax has fallen from £2,987,199 to |
£2,953,776. After taxation and dividends £(210,814) has been deducted from reserves. |
|
As for many businesses of our size, the business environment in which we operate continues to be challenging. We are |
subject to consumer spending patterns and consumers' overall level of disposable income within our economy. |
|
With these risks and uncertainties in mind, we are aware that any plans for the future development of the business may |
be subject to unforeseen events outside of our control. |

1. | ACCOUNTING POLICIES |
|
Basis of preparing the financial statements |
|
|
Related party exemption |
The company has taken advantage of exemption, under the terms of Financial Reporting Standard 102 'The |
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and Republic of Ireland', not to disclose related party |
transactions with wholly owned subsidiaries within the group. |
|
Turnover |
Turnover is generated from operating express & local coach services across the UK and the private hire of |
luxury coaches to the general public. |
|
Tangible fixed assets |
Depreciation is provided at the following annual rates in order to write off each asset over its estimated useful |
life. |
|
Computer equipment | - | 25% on cost |
Plant and machinery | - | 10% to 25% on cost |
Fixtures and fittings | - | 25% on cost |
Motor vehicles | - | 25% on cost |
Coaches | - | from 10% on cost |
|
Stocks |
Stocks are valued at the lower of cost and net realisable value, after making due allowance for obsolete and slow |
moving items. |
|
Deferred tax |
Deferred tax is recognised in respect of all timing differences that have originated but not reversed at the balance |
sheet date. |
|
Foreign currencies |
Assets and liabilities in foreign currencies are translated into sterling at the rates of exchange ruling at the |
balance sheet date. Transactions in foreign currencies are translated into sterling at the rate of exchange ruling |
at the date of transaction. Exchange differences are taken into account in arriving at the operating result. |
|
Hire purchase and leasing commitments |
Assets obtained under hire purchase contracts or finance leases are capitalised in the balance sheet. Those held |
under hire purchase contracts are depreciated over their estimated useful lives. Those held under finance leases |
are depreciated over their estimated useful lives or the lease term, whichever is the shorter. |
|
The interest element of these obligations is charged to profit or loss over the relevant period. The capital element |
of the future payments is treated as a liability. |
|
Pension costs and other post-retirement benefits |
The company operates a defined contribution pension scheme. Contributions payable to the company's pension |
scheme are charged to profit or loss in the period to which they relate. |
